TFRD Participated in the Asia-pacific Conference on Human Genetics and Asia LSD Symposium
“The 12th Asia-Pacific Conference on Human Genetics(APCHG)” and “the 18th Asia LSD Symposium” were held in Bangkok, Thailand from November 8th to 11th. With the introduction of Next Generation Sequencing(NGS), the era of Genomics Medicine has come and the topic of the 12th APCHG, “Genomic Medicine and Clinic Practice”, focused on the importance of NGS on clinical practice.
Dr. Chung from Hong Kong mentioned that NGS not only is utilized in disease diagnosis, but will be a trend adapted in prenatal exams in the future, which allows a 6.25 % increase on the detection rate of birth defects. However, the huge costs of prenatal exams, the long period of examination time, the correlation between the detected genes and the clinical practice are still unsolved puzzles. Regarding the treatments of diseases, Dr. Y-T Chen, the former chairman, said that even with the introduction of ERT, the enzyme replacement therapy, there are still difficulties in the treatment of Pompe Disease: that is, how to make the medicine delivered into skeletal muscle and improve the symptom of muscle fatigue. Nevertheless, the researchers are still working hard on finding new treatments, such as the second generation of chaperon treatment, gene therapy…and so on. The results are worth expecting.
In the conference, Asia LSD Symposium invited Ms. Ruth Kuan-Ju Chen, the Executive Director of TFRD, as the speaker. Ms. Chen mentioned that with complete genetic consulting, more families will be able to get to know the disease, medical care, and the correct information, which will help them clearly evaluate the risks and lower the harm concerning next generation breeding.
